To solve the equation \(2(x + 8) = 2x + 8\) and justify each step, we can proceed as follows:

**Step 1:** Use the **Distributive Property** to simplify the left side of the equation.

\[
2(x + 8) = 2x + 16
\]

Now the equation reads:

\[
2x + 16 = 2x + 8
\]

**Step 2:** Use the **Subtraction of Equality** property to isolate the variable.

Subtract \(2x\) from both sides:

\[
2x + 16 - 2x = 2x + 8 - 2x
\]

This simplifies to:

\[
16 = 8
\]

At this point, we observe that we have an equation that is not true (16 does not equal 8). This indicates that there are no solutions to the original equation.

For this equation, there are:

1. Properties used:
- **Distributive Property** (used in Step 1)
- **Subtraction of Equality** (used in Step 2)

Thus, the final conclusion is:

**There is no solution.**

The clearly stated steps would be:
- Step 1: **Distributive Property**
- Step 2: **Subtraction of Equality**

And the final answer for the nature of solutions:
- There are **no solutions** because the equation \(16 = 8\) is false.
